A respected chieftain of the All Progressives Congress (APC) in Ondo State, Engr. Olufemi Kolawole, has risen in strong defence of Hon. Olabintan, following the circulation of a leaked audio recording attributed to him. Kolawole described the development as a calculated and malicious attempt to damage Olabintan’s reputation and frustrate his ambition to emerge as the next APC State Chairman.

In a well-articulated statement shared on his Facebook page, Kolawole condemned the secret recording and its public release, describing it as the handiwork of a mischievous individual seeking to incite disunity within the party and misrepresent Olabintan’s genuine intentions.

> “I have listened to the audio recording, which was made by an unscrupulous person who saw an opportunity to bring Hon. Olabintan down. It was secretly recorded and deliberately released with the selfish aim of damaging his image and truncating his aspiration to lead the APC in Ondo State,” Kolawole stated.

 

He stressed that contrary to the false narratives being pushed around, there is no credible evidence in the audio suggesting that Hon. Olabintan indicted Governor Lucky Ayedatiwa or acted against the interest of the party.

> “What I observe is that the opposition is celebrating what they perceive as negativity. This is nothing but an attempt to strain the cordial relationship between Hon. Olabintan and the governor,” he added, describing the act as a calculated ploy to create internal crisis at a sensitive political moment.

 

Kolawole maintained that Hon. Olabintan’s remarks in the recording were aligned with the values of party loyalty and internal discipline. He urged party stakeholders to take inspiration from the era of the late Governor Olusegun Agagu, which was marked by unity and merit-based recognition.

> “Olabintan simply made objective observations and offered thoughtful suggestions on party leadership. In those days, recognition came through hard work, sacrifice, loyalty, and consistent dedication to party ideals—not by mere affiliations,” he said, referencing Omoogun’s Timeless Principles of Party Loyalty in Nigeria (2018).

 

He also drew parallels with Lagos State, recalling how former Governor Akinwunmi Ambode was denied a second term primarily due to a disconnect with party structures, despite commendable infrastructural achievements.

Kolawole explained that if given the opportunity to serve as APC Chairman in Ondo State, Hon. Olabintan would work closely with the governor to ensure true party loyalists at the grassroots are empowered and the party structure is strengthened.

> “The governor cannot know every loyal member at the grassroots level. That is why a strong and disciplined party leadership is essential. It helps to foster loyalty, maintain internal harmony, and position the party for electoral victory,” Kolawole stressed, citing the Nigeria Political Party Dynamics Report (2022).

 

He further affirmed that the relationship between Governor Ayedatiwa and Hon. Olabintan remains unbroken and grounded in mutual respect and shared values.

> “There is no credible basis to believe that any opposition conspiracy can damage the strong bond between the governor and Hon. Olabintan. Their collaboration is crucial to the progress of Ondo State,” he said.

 

Kolawole concluded by calling on APC members to unite, promote internal discipline, and reject divisive politics.

> “Any attempt to misrepresent or undermine Hon. Olabintan’s genuine contributions is unjust and misdirected. Our collective focus should be on building consensus, strengthening party institutions, and supporting democratic ideals. Let us come together and move the Ondo APC forward.”
